Security

Online shopping is a convenient method to purchase products and services, however security issues can pose a problem for some consumers. Online store owners can take various steps to safeguard their customers from theft of their personal data and also to safeguard themselves. These include the use of SSL encryption along with two-factor authentication as well as displaying trust seals that are verified. Reputable ecommerce websites also ensure that their payment processing pages have been encrypted. This protects the personal information of shoppers from hackers who might intercept communications between the customer and the site.

Another way to increase your security when shopping online is to make use of a secure Wi-Fi network. This will keep hackers out of your private information, including login credentials and credit card numbers. You can also purchase a virtual card to minimize the risk. This can be obtained from your credit card company by asking for a temporary credit card number.

SSL encryption is used by a majority of online stores. This ensures that information sent to a site is encrypted, making it unreadable to outsiders. The URL in the address bar of your browser will tell you if a site is SSL-secured. A padlock icon will be displayed, and the URL should start with HTTPS. Using this encryption will also aid you in avoiding becoming a victim of cybercrimes such as phishing attacks and other.

To make your ecommerce experience as secure as you can it is advised to avoid connecting or linking your bank or credit card account information directly with the online store. Instead, you should opt for an electronic wallet such as Apple Pay or Google Pay. These services encrypt information and can be used for online or in-person purchases. In addition, you should be sure to check your accounts frequently and enable alerts or notifications about transactions.

To ensure that you are safe shopping online, it is recommended to employ a password manager and keep your antimalware and antivirus software updated. You should also alter the default passwords for your online shopping to something more complicated. You should also enable two-factor authentication. This requires an authentic username and password, as well as an autogenerated code to be entered on your device.
